Job Description The Associate Director, Nonclinical Sciences Program Management & Strategic Operations (PMSO) is responsible for the integration, planning, coordination, and execution of complex pharmaceutical development programs across the nonclinical development lifecycle. Working closely with Project Leaders, functional subject matter experts, Regulatory Affairs, and external partners, this individual develops and maintains integrated project and submission plans to ensure key development and regulatory milestones are achieved on time and within budget. In addition to leading core program management activities, this role serves as a key operational lead for nonclinical regulatory deliverables supporting global marketing applications (NDA/BLA), health authority interactions, lifecycle management submissions, and post-marketing commitments, while also contributing to earlier-stage IND/CTA activities. The incumbent partners closely with Regulatory Affairs and cross-functional subject matter experts to coordinate planning, authoring, review, approval, and execution of nonclinical submission content across major regulatory milestones. This role also provides comprehensive communication, status reporting, risk management, and issue escalation support to cross-functional stakeholders and senior leadership.
